


So schreiben Sie einfache SQL -Abfrageanweisungen nach der MySQL -Installation
Apr 08, 2025 am 10:54 AMIn diesem Artikel wird die grundlegenden Vorg?nge der MySQL -Datenbank vorgestellt und die Schritte zum Schreiben der ersten SQL -Anweisung enth?lt: 1. verwenden Sie SELECT * von Benutzern; alle Benutzerinformationen abfragen; 2. Verwenden Sie ausgew?hlten Benutzernamen, E -Mail von Benutzern. Abfragen angegebene Felder; 3.. Verwenden Sie die Klausel zur bedingten Filterung; 4. Verwenden Sie die Reihenfolge nach Klausel, um die Ergebnisse zu sortieren. Der Artikel erinnert Sie auch daran, die Fallempfindlichkeit, SQL -Injektionsrisiken und Fehlerbehandlung zu beachten. Es wird empfohlen, mehr zu üben, um SQL kompetent zu beherrschen.
MySQL Erste Erfahrung: Von der Installation zu Ihrer ersten SQL -Anweisung
Sie haben MySQL installiert und sind bestrebt, einige SQL -Anweisungen zu schreiben, wissen aber nicht, wo Sie anfangen sollen? Mach dir keine Sorgen, dieser Artikel ist für dich. Ich werde Sie mit der einfachsten Abfrage beginnen, den Charme von SQL nach und nach verstehen und einige der Erfahrungen und Lektionen teilen, die ich im Laufe der Jahre angesammelt habe, um Ihnen zu helfen, Umwege zu vermeiden.
Mysql ist der Kern der Datenbank. Stellen Sie sich eine super leistungsstarke Tabelle vor, mit der massive Datenmengen gespeichert werden k?nnen und es Ihnen erm?glichen, Informationen mit Blitzgeschwindigkeit abzurufen. SQL (strukturierte Abfragesprache) ist die Sprache, die Sie mit dieser Tabelle kommunizieren.
Wir beginnen mit den grundlegendsten Konzepten: Datenbanken, Tabellen und Felder. Einfach ausgedrückt, eine Datenbank ist ein Container, eine Tabelle ist eine Schublade im Container und ein Feld ist ein Gitter in der Schublade. M?glicherweise haben Sie eine Datenbank (z. B. mydatabase
) erstellt und eine Tabelle (z. B. users
) darin erstellt. Diese Tabelle kann einige Felder haben, z. B. id
(Benutzer -ID), username
(Benutzername) und email
(E -Mail -Adresse).
Schreiben wir jetzt die erste SQL -Abfrageanweisung, das Ziel ist es, alle Benutzerinformationen aus der Tabelle users
abzufragen:
<code class="sql">SELECT <em>FROM users;</em></code>
Diese Codezeile ist pr?gnant und klar. SELECT
die Auswahl aller Felder aus FROM users
aus der users
auszuw?hlen. Führen Sie diese Anweisung aus und Sie sehen alle Daten in der users
.
Wenn Sie nur den Benutzernamen und die E -Mail -Adresse anzeigen m?chten, k?nnen Sie sie so schreiben:
<code class="sql">SELECT username, email FROM users;</code>
Dies ist nur die einfachste Abfrage. Die Kraft von SQL ist seine Flexibilit?t und ihren Feature -Reichtum. Sie k?nnen beispielsweise die WHERE
-Klausel für die bedingte Filterung verwenden:
<code class="sql">SELECT <em>FROM users WHERE username = 'john_doe';</em></code>
Diese Anweisung gibt nur Benutzerinformationen mit dem Benutzernamen john_doe
zurück. Beachten Sie, dass Saiten in einzelnen Zitaten eingeschlossen sein müssen.
Beispielsweise k?nnen Sie ORDER BY
Klausel verwenden, um die Ergebnisse zu sortieren:
<code class="sql">SELECT FROM users ORDER BY id DESC;</code>
Sortiert die Ergebnisse in absteigender Reihenfolge id
-Feldes. DESC
bedeutet absteigender Reihenfolge, ASC
bedeutet aufsteigende Reihenfolge (Standard).
Hier ist ein Tipp: In gro?en Datenbanken ist SELECT *
ineffizient, da er alle Felder liest, auch wenn Sie nur einen Teil davon ben?tigen. Entwickeln Sie gute Gewohnheiten und w?hlen Sie nur die Felder aus, die Sie ben?tigen.
Sprechen Sie neben einigen h?ufigen Fallstricks:
- Fallempfindlichkeit: MySQL ist in der Regel in Bezug auf Datenbanknamen und Tabellennamen, aber manchmal fallsempfindlich an Feldnamen und -werte (abh?ngig von Ihrer Konfiguration). Um unn?tigen ?rger zu vermeiden, ist es am besten, immer Kleinbuchstaben zu verwenden.
- SQL -Injektion: Niemals die Benutzereingabe direkt in SQL -Anweisungen eingeben, da dies schwerwiegende Sicherheitsrisiken bringt und anf?llig für SQL -Injektionsangriffe ist. Verwenden Sie parametrisierte Abfragen oder vorkompilierte Aussagen, um die SQL -Injektion zu verhindern.
- Fehlerbehebung: Erfahren Sie, wie Sie mit SQL -Fehlern wie Verbindungsfehlern, Abfragemausern usw. umgehen, was für den Aufbau robuster Anwendungen von entscheidender Bedeutung ist.
Am Ende reicht es nicht aus, ein SQL -Meister zu werden, nur Artikel zu lesen. Sie müssen mehr üben, verschiedene Abfrageinrichtungen mehr ausprobieren und versuchen, einige komplexe Szenarien zu behandeln. Nur durch st?ndiges Lernen und üben k?nnen Sie diese m?chtige Sprache wirklich beherrschen. Denken Sie daran, Praxis bringt wahres Wissen!
Das obige ist der detaillierte Inhalt vonSo schreiben Sie einfache SQL -Abfrageanweisungen nach der MySQL -Installation.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Hei?e KI -Werkzeuge

Undress AI Tool
Ausziehbilder kostenlos

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Clothoff.io
KI-Kleiderentferner

Video Face Swap
Tauschen Sie Gesichter in jedem Video mühelos mit unserem v?llig kostenlosen KI-Gesichtstausch-Tool aus!

Hei?er Artikel

Hei?e Werkzeuge

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Der Blockchain -Browser ist ein notwendiges Tool zur Abfragetation digitaler W?hrungsinformationen. Es bietet eine visuelle Schnittstelle für Blockchain -Daten, damit Benutzer Transaktions -Hash, Blockh?he, Adressausgleich und andere Informationen abfragen k?nnen. Das Arbeitsprinzip umfasst Datensynchronisation, Parsen, Indizierung und Benutzeroberfl?che. Kernfunktionen decken Abfrage -Transaktionsdetails, Blockinformationen, Adressausgleich, Token -Daten und Netzwerkstatus ab. Wenn Sie es verwenden, müssen Sie TXID erhalten und den entsprechenden Blockchain -Browser wie Ethercan oder Blockchain.com für die Suche ausw?hlen. Abfragedateninformationen zum Anzeigen des Gleichgewichts- und Transaktionsverlaufs, indem Sie die Adresse eingeben; Zu den Mainstream -Browsern geh?ren Bitcoin's Blockchain.com, Etherscan.io von Ethereum, B

Blockchain ist eine verteilte und dezentrale digitale Ledger -Technologie. Zu den Kernprinzipien geh?ren: 1. Distributed Ledger stellt sicher, dass Daten gleichzeitig auf allen Knoten gespeichert werden. 2. Verschlüsselungstechnologie, Verknüpfung von Bl?cken über Hash -Werte, um sicherzustellen, dass Daten nicht manipuliert werden; 3.. Konsensmechanismen wie POW oder POS stellen sicher, dass Transaktionen zwischen Knoten vereinbart werden. 4. Dezentralisierung, Beseitigung eines einzelnen Kontrollpunkts, Verbesserung der Zensurresistenz; 5. Smart Contracts, Protokolle für die automatisierte Ausführung. Kryptow?hrungen sind digitale Verm?genswerte, die auf Blockchain ausgestellt werden. Der Betriebsprozess ist: 1. Der Benutzer initiiert Transaktionen und Zeichen digital; 2. Die Transaktionen werden an das Netzwerk übertragen; 3. Der Bergmann oder der Verifizierer überprüft die Gültigkeit der Transaktion; 4.. Mehrere Transaktionen werden in neue Bl?cke verpackt. 5. Best?tigen Sie die neue Zone durch den Konsensmechanismus

Durch seine Turing-Complete-intelligenten Vertr?ge, EVM-virtuellen Maschinen und Gasmechanismen hat Ethereum eine programmierbare Blockchain-Plattform über Bitcoin hinaus entwickelt, die diversifizierte Anwendungs?kosysteme wie Defi und NFT unterstützt. Zu den Kernvorteilen z?hlen ein reichhaltiges DAPP-?kosystem, eine starke Programmierbarkeit, die aktive Entwicklergemeinschaft und eine interoperabilische Interoperabilit?t der Kette. Derzeit implementiert es die Konsenstransformation von POW zu POS durch das Upgrade von Ethereum 2.0 und führt die Einführung von Beacon -Ketten, Verifizierermechanismen und Bestrafungssystemen zur Verbesserung der Energieeffizienz, Sicherheit und Dezentralisierung. In Zukunft wird es auf die Sharding -Technologie beruhen, um Daten zu realisieren, die Daten Sharding und parallele Verarbeitung zu realisieren, wodurch der Durchsatz erheblich verbessert wird. Gleichzeitig wurde die Rollup-Technologie h?ufig als Layer-2-L?sung, optimistische Rollup und ZK-Rollu verwendet

Blockchain ist eine dezentrale verteilte Ledger-Technologie, die sicherstellt, dass die Daten durch Verschlüsselungsalgorithmen und Konsensmechanismen manipulationssicher und sicher und vertrauenswürdig sind und einen h?heren Transparenz- und Risikowiderstand aufweisen als herk?mmliche zentrale Datenbanken. 1. Blockchain ist mit Bl?cken verknüpft, und jeder Block enth?lt Transaktionsdaten und durch kryptografische Methoden verbunden. 2. Seine Kernmerkmale umfassen Dezentralisierung, verteiltes Ledger, manipulationssicher, Transparenz, Verschlüsselungssicherheit und Konsensmechanismus; 3.. Digitale W?hrungen wie Bitcoin arbeiten basierend auf Blockchain, und Transaktionen werden durch die gesamten Netzwerkknoten überprüft und in den Block gepackt, um Offenheit und Transparenz zu gew?hrleisten und unver?nderlich. 4. ?ffentliche Schlüssel werden verwendet, um digitale W?hrung zu erhalten, und private Schlüssel sind die einzigen Gutscheine, die Verm?genswerte kontrollieren und müssen ausschlie?lich vertraulich sein. 5. Die Methode des sicheren Sorgerechts für private Schlüssel umfasst die Verwendung von Hardwarespeichern und Papier

Verzeichnis Was ist pr?gnant (beweisen), wer pr?gnant (beweisen)? Welches Risikokapital unterstützt pr?gnant (beweisen)? Wie pr?gnant (beweisen) funktioniert sp1zkvm und Prover Network opsuccincinct Technology Cross-Chain-überprüfung beweisen Token Economics Token Details Token Allocation Token Utility Potential Token Inhaber Inhaber Beweisen Token Preis Vorhersage Beweisen Sie Token Pre-Market Trading Aktivit?ten Community Prediction of Provit token Price Warum Succ

Inhaltsverzeichnis Momofun Preisanalyse Was ist Momofun? AI-betriebenes AI-Agent AI Pool bietet intelligente Liquidit?tstechnologie Rückgrat: Wie das Memefi-Modell von Eliza Framework Momofun MOMOFUNs zukünftige Momofun-Preisanalyse ** Preis ** 0,003709 ** Marktwert ** 29.533.834 ** Zirkulationsversorgung ** 7,800.000.000 mm ** Total Acts. Funktionen im System -?kosystem: Governance und Abstimmung (Abstimmung

Die European Exchange ist eine weltweit führende Digital Asset Service-Plattform, die den Nutzern vielf?ltige digitale Produkthandel und Finanzdienstleistungen bietet. Die offizielle Bewerbung ist mit einem bequemen Betrieb konzipiert und ist bestrebt, eine sichere und stabile Handelsumgebung für Benutzer zu schaffen.

ETH Exchange USDC eignet sich besser für Benutzer, die Liquidit?t und plattformübergreifende Kompatibilit?t verfolgen, w?hrend die Erl?sung DAI für Benutzer, die am Defi- und DAO-?kosystem teilnehmen, besser geeignet sind. 1. Die zentralisierte Plattformgebühr betr?gt 0,1%~ 0,2%, und die DEX -Kommission h?ngt von der Gasgebühr ab. Das Hauptnetz betr?gt ungef?hr 3 bis 6 US -Dollar, und Layer2 kann weniger als 0,1 US -Dollar betragen. 2. In Bezug auf die Ankunftsgeschwindigkeit der Kontostand ist die zentralisierte Plattform fast in Echtzeit, wobei durchschnittliche Transaktionen auf Ketten durchschnittlich 30 Sekunden bis 2 Minuten; 3. USDC -Handelspaare sind reichhaltiger und flüssiger. Dai ist im Defi -Protokoll sehr anpassungsf?hig und die Handhabungsgebühr ist in einigen Pools etwas niedriger. 4. Es wird empfohlen, maximale Netzbetriebsvorg?nge zu vermeiden, und es wird eine geringe Erl?sung bevorzugt. DEX -Transaktionen achten auf die Sicherheit der Vertragsberechtigung, um die Kompatibilit?t von Stablecoin -Abhebungsnetzwerk zu gew?hrleisten. Beide sind in der Handhabungsgebühr.
